Women’s ACHA Ice Hockey Skates to 3-3 Tie with Jamestown

Women's ACHA ice hockey skated to a 3-3 tie with the University of Jamestown Sunday afternoon at Northwest Arena in Jamestown, North Dakota.

The Jimmies jumped in front at the 15:18 mark of the first on a power play after the Lions were called for cross-checking at 13:50, but Lindenwood responded quickly with an even-strength effort just over a minute later. Loki Antonio scored her 15th of the season off a feed from Ardyn Hawryshko with 3:36 remaining in the period and it was 1-1 at the end of the first 20-minutes.

Antonio sounded the horn again just 11-seconds into the second on a play set up by Hawryshko and Alison Blaskovich to give Lindenwood a 2-1 advantage, but Jamestown knotted the game again at the nine-minute mark. The Jimmies were called for high-sticking moments later and that led to a Lions power play goal from Hawryshko at 12:01. Madison Teague earned her 16th assist of the season while Ava Bilton received the secondary assist and Lindenwood had a 3-2 lead, but it only lasted 54-seconds. The Jimmies tied the score at three and that's where it remained for the rest of the second and the entire third period.

The Lions put three pucks on goal in the five-minute overtime period while holding Jamestown shotless but could not get a game-winner.
Lindenwood outshot the Jimmies 40-39 and Jordan Tung stopped 36 of the 39 shots she faced in goal. The Lions scored once on two power play chances while holding Jamestown to a goal on four man-advantage chances.

Lindenwood finished its North Dakota trip with a record of 1-1-1 and the Lions are now 3-5-1 in the Women's Midwest College Hockey conference and 6-7-1 overall. They have another three-game weekend scheduled November 7-9 when Minot State, Jamestown and Minnesota come to town. The opening faceoff against the Beavers is scheduled for 1:30 p.m. on Thursday, at 9:20 p.m. versus the Jimmies on Friday, and at 9 p.m. against the Gophers on Saturday with all three games taking place at the Centene Community Ice Center in Maryland Heights, Missouri.
